Strawberry Cucumber Salad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to whip up this delightful dish!
For the Dressing
- Balsamic Vinegar – Adds a tangy flavor and depth to the dressing; lime juice can be a zesty alternative.
- Honey – Provides natural sweetness to balance the tartness; try agave syrup for a vegan option.
For the Salad
- Strawberries – Juicy and sweet, they are the star of this salad; opt for ripe, seasonal strawberries for the best taste.
- English Cucumber – Offers a satisfying crunch and hydration; substitute with pickling cucumbers if necessary.
- Fresh Mint – Infuses a refreshing herbal note; fresh basil can also work beautifully as a substitute.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Strawberry Cucumber Salad with Honey Balsamic Dressing
Step 1: Make the Dressing
In a small mixing bowl, whisk together 2 tablespoons of balsamic vinegar and 2 tablespoons of honey until well combined, creating a smooth and glossy dressing. Let the mixture sit for about 5 minutes to allow the flavors to meld, while you prepare the salad ingredients, ensuring that your dressing is ready when you’re finished.
Step 2: Prepare the Strawberries
Wash and hull 1 pint of ripe strawberries, then slice them into halves or quarters, depending on their size. As you slice, keep an eye out for firmness and vibrant color, indicating their freshness. Place the cut strawberries in a large serving bowl, preparing them to mingle with the other bright ingredients in your delicious Strawberry Cucumber Salad.
Step 3: Slice the Cucumber
Take 1 English cucumber and wash it thoroughly to remove any residue. Slice the cucumber into thin rounds or half-moons, ensuring they are a uniform thickness for even texture. Add the cucumber slices to the bowl with the strawberries, creating a colorful visual contrast and adding that lovely crispness we crave in a refreshing salad.
Step 4: Chop the Mint
Rinse a handful of fresh mint leaves under cool water to clean them, then pat them dry gently with a kitchen towel. Julienne or finely chop 1 tablespoon of the mint, releasing its fragrant oils. Sprinkle this vibrant herb over the strawberries and cucumber, enhancing the refreshing quality of your Strawberry Cucumber Salad with Honey Balsamic Dressing.
Step 5: Combine Ingredients
Drizzle the prepared honey balsamic dressing over the salad, allowing it to coat each piece of fruit and cucumber. Using tongs or a large spoon, gently toss the ingredients together until everything is evenly mixed, ensuring each bite is packed with flavor and color. This gentle tossing will keep the strawberries intact while blending the flavors brilliantly.
Step 6: Serve or Chill
Once your Strawberry Cucumber Salad with Honey Balsamic Dressing is beautifully mixed, serve it immediately for the best flavor and texture. Alternatively, if you prefer the flavors to meld, let it chill in the refrigerator for about 10 to 15 minutes. This will enhance the salad’s flavors, providing a refreshing experience as you dig in.

How to Store and Freeze Strawberry Cucumber Salad
Fridge: Store the assembled Strawberry Cucumber Salad in an airtight container for up to 1 day. To maintain freshness, keep the dressing separate until ready to serve.
Components: For longer storage, keep the salad components—strawberries, cucumbers, and dressing—stored separately in the fridge. This way, you can enjoy fresh crunch and flavor whenever you’re ready.
Freezer: It’s not recommended to freeze this salad, as cucumbers can lose their crisp texture and both strawberries and the dressing may change in quality. Stick to fresh ingredients for the best taste!
Reheating: Since this salad is served cold, there’s no need for reheating. Serve it straight from the fridge for a refreshing bite!

Make Ahead Options
Preparing your Strawberry Cucumber Salad with Honey Balsamic Dressing ahead of time is a dream for busy cooks! You can slice the cucumbers and strawberries up to 24 hours in advance, storing them separ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ator to maintain their freshness and crunch. The honey balsamic dressing can also be whisked together and refrigerated for up to 3 days; its flavors will deepen over time. To serve, simply combine the prepped ingredients and dressing, tossing gently to avoid crushing the strawberries. Expert Tips for Strawberry Cucumber Salad
-
Crisp Cucumber: To maintain the crunch of your cucumbers, consume the salad quickly or salt them beforehand to draw out excess moisture.
-
Freshness is Key: For the best flavor, use ripe, seasonal strawberries in your Strawberry Cucumber Salad with Honey Balsamic Dressing.
-
Prep Ahead: To save time, you can prep the salad components, storing fruits and dressing separately until serving to maintain freshness.
-
Herb Variations: Experiment with herbs! While mint is delightful, fresh basil provides a unique twist that can complement the flavors beautifully.
-
Dress Before Serving: If you prefer a lighter salad, consider dressing it just before serving to keep the ingredients fresh and avoid sogginess.

How can I troubleshoot if my salad is too sweet or too tangy?
Very! If your salad is too sweet, try balancing it with a little more acidity. Add a squeeze of fresh lemon juice or a dash more balsamic vinegar, and mix well. If it’s too tangy, add a touch of honey or even a pinch of sugar to round out the flavors. Taste and adjust as you go; a little goes a long way!
